To enjoy movies with natural color, you'll want a Dolby Vision HDR TV. Featuring a high contrast ratio, Dolby Vision HDR TVs offer a starker difference between the lightest whites and darkest blacks in order to create a more natural and dynamic appearance. They have dynamic metadata, which is able to determine how best to show each shot or scene and adjust brightness levels accordingly. They have automatic adaption capabilities, enabling pictures and audio to automatically adjust to the TVs display and speakers, delivering the best possible viewing experience. Dolby Vision HDR TVs have 12-bit color depth, reducing overtly obvious gradations between shades to produce more lifelike scenes. However, they require special hardware, including a newer HDMI, in order to function properly.

Achieve the Ultimate Viewing Experience by Deciding on the Best Display for Your Dolby Vision HDR TV
OLED TVs

Great quality OLED will benefit everyone. Luckily, there are 17 options available for your Dolby Vision HDR TV which will be perfect for friends to gather together and watch your favorite movies and shows. OLED TVs are able to completely shut off various individual pixels throughout the screen when illumination is not needed, making them more energy efficient. Using pixel dimming, they are able to darken independently, reducing any blurring. They feature wider viewing angles and self-illuminating displays, so they are made up of millions of individually controlled pixels which can be turned off and on independently to deliver enhanced detail, color, and shades in every scene. These TVs come in a large variety of sizes and don't require a separate backlight, allowing manufacturers to create ultra-thin displays. With a high contrast ratio, they produce incredibly rich and clear detail. They can completely switch off individual pixels to produce deeper black levels, which are vital for greater picture quality. However, they are made with relatively new technology, so if you're shopping on a budget, these types of TVs might not be the best option for you. In addition, they are usually only available with big screens, so they aren't ideal if you live in a small house or apartment. LED TVs

If you don't know which display type is right for you, consider this option for your Dolby Vision HDR TV. These LED TVs are lightweight, making them easier to install and mount. They are designed with sleek displays and come in numerous sizes. They have different kinds of backlighting options, which are responsible for illuminating the screen. They feature local dimming technology, delivering deeper tones of black by dividing the display into zones and enabling the lighter aspects of a scene to remain illuminated, while the darker parts dim to produce more true-to-life pictures. They are able to cut off the power supply to various sections of the screen in order to save energy. They feature Quantum Dot technology, which will deliver truer colors and tones. However, they have more dimension depth, which makes them difficult to mount on the wall. Moreover, these LED TVs have poor off-angle viewing, so the picture quality and color suffer when not viewed from a standard angle.
